Odwołania do struktury AGpsRilInterface

Odwołania do struktury AGpsRilInterface

#include < gps.h >

Pola danych

size_t  size
 
void(*  init )( AGpsRilCallbacks *callbacks)
 
void(*  set_ref_location )(const AGpsRefLocation *agps_reflocation, size_t sz_struct)
 
void(*  set_set_id )( AGpsSetIDType type, const char *setid)
 
void(*  ni_message )(uint8_t *msg, size_t len)
 
void(*  update_network_state )(int connected, int type, int roaming, const char *extra_info)
 
void(*  update_network_availability )(int avaiable, const char *apn)
 

Szczegółowy opis

Rozszerzony interfejs do obsługi AGPS_RIL.

Definicja w wierszu 1145 pliku gps.h .

Dokumentacja pola

void(* init)( AGpsRilCallbacks *callbacks)

Otwiera interfejs AGPS i zapewnia procedury wywołania zwrotnego do implementacji tego interfejsu.

Definicja w wierszu 1152 pliku gps.h .

void(* ni_message)(uint8_t *msg, size_t len)

Wyślij wiadomość inicjowaną przez sieć.

Definicja w wierszu 1166 pliku gps.h .

void(* set_ref_location)(const AGpsRefLocation *agps_reflocation, size_t sz_struct)

Ustawia lokalizację odniesienia.

Definicja w wierszu 1157 pliku gps.h .

void(* set_set_id)( AGpsSetIDType type, const char *setid)

Ustawia identyfikator zestawu.

Definicja w wierszu 1161 pliku gps.h .

size_t size

Ustaw na sizeof(AGpsRilInterface)

Definicja w wierszu 1147 pliku gps.h .

void(* update_network_availability)(int avaiable, const char *apn)

Informowanie usługi GPS o zmianach stanu sieci. Te parametry są zgodne z wartościami w klasie android.net.NetworkInfo.

Definicja w wierszu 1178 pliku gps.h .

void(* update_network_state)(int connected, int type, int roaming, const char *extra_info)

Informowanie GPS o zmianach stanu sieci. Te parametry są zgodne z wartościami w klasie android.net.NetworkInfo.

Definicja w wierszu 1172 pliku gps.h .


Dokumentacja tego typu danych została wygenerowana z tego pliku:
  • hardware/libhardware/include/hardware/ gps.h